#6ff016 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ff016 is composed of 43.5% red, 94.1%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.8%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 95.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 51.4%. #6ff016 color hex could be obtained by blending #deff2c with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

#6ff016 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6ff016 has RGB values of R:111, G:240,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 7335958.

Shades and Tints of #6ff016
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030700 is the darkest color, while #f8f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ff016
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#82877f is the less saturated color, while #6dfa0c is the most saturated one.
